The LT1011CS8#TRPBF is a precision comparator integrated circuit chip manufactured by Analog Devices. It offers several advantages and can be used in various application scenarios. Some of the advantages and application scenarios of the LT1011CS8#TRPBF are:Advantages: 1. Precision: The LT1011CS8#TRPBF provides high accuracy and precision in comparing analog voltages. It has a low input offset voltage and low input bias current, ensuring accurate comparisons.2. Low Power Consumption: This chip is designed to operate with low power consumption, making it suitable for battery-powered applications or any scenario where power efficiency is crucial.3. Wide Supply Voltage Range: The LT1011CS8#TRPBF can operate with a wide supply voltage range, typically from 2.5V to 36V. This flexibility allows it to be used in various voltage environments.4. Fast Response Time: It has a fast response time, enabling quick and accurate comparisons of input voltages.Application Scenarios: 1. Voltage Monitoring: The LT1011CS8#TRPBF can be used in voltage monitoring applications, where it compares a reference voltage with the input voltage and provides an output signal based on the comparison result. This is useful in battery management systems, power supply monitoring, or overvoltage/undervoltage protection circuits.2. Oscillators and Timers: The LT1011CS8#TRPBF can be used in oscillator and timer circuits, where it compares the voltage levels of different components to generate precise timing signals. This is applicable in applications such as frequency generators, pulse-width modulation (PWM) circuits, or time-delay circuits.3. Signal Conditioning: It can be used in signal conditioning circuits, where it compares the input signal with a reference voltage to amplify, filter, or modify the signal based on the comparison result. This is useful in audio amplifiers, filters, or signal level detectors.4. Control Systems: The LT1011CS8#TRPBF can be used in control systems, where it compares different input voltages to determine the control action. This is applicable in motor control, robotics, or feedback control systems.Overall, the LT1011CS8#TRPBF integrated circuit chip offers precision, low power consumption, wide supply voltage range, and fast response time, making it suitable for various applications requiring accurate voltage comparisons.
